Output ec5c749e239d83476df65c4178c340d2b1c4437ad65f1a4047327536f0bc180f:2

value
452033867
script pubkey
OP_0 OP_PUSHBYTES_20 6e580675c1634404297abd4469800e5e6e9671a8
address
bc1qdevqvawpvdzqg2t6h4zxnqqwtehfvudg4srnns
transaction
ec5c749e239d83476df65c4178c340d2b1c4437ad65f1a4047327536f0bc180f
spent
true